XXV World Rhythmic Gymnastics Championships were held in New Orleans, United States from 10 to 14 July 2002. The competition was open to groups only and the designated apparatuses were Ribbon and Ball & Rope.

Competitors

There were participants from 25 countries including Belarus, Brazil, Bulgaria, Canada, China, Cuba, France, Germany, Greece, Hungary, Italy, Japan, Poland, Russia, Slovakia, South Korea, Spain, Switzerland, Ukraine and United States.
